Blend the smoothie on high for about 1-2 minutes until the mixture is smooth and creamy. The exact time may vary depending on the power of your blender.
If you're looking for a substitute for whey protein powder, you can use plant-based protein powder or Greek yogurt as alternatives, keeping in mind that it may alter the flavor and texture.
You can store leftover smoothie in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ours. However, it's best enjoyed fresh for optimal flavor and texture.
If your smoothie is too thick, simply add a little more milk (2% or any preferred dairy/non-dairy milk) and blend briefly until you reach your desired consistency.
This smoothie contains milk and heavy whipping cream, which are not lactose-free. For a lactose-free version, use lactose-free milk and a lactose-free protein powder.
- Use a ripe banana for added sweetness and a creamier texture.
- Frozen strawberries can be used if fresh ones are not available; this will also give the smoothie a thicker consistency.
- Blend the ingredients starting at a low speed and gradually increase to high to ensure a smooth texture.
- Add a handful of ice cubes if you prefer a colder and thicker smoothie.
- Experiment with different types of whey protein powder flavors to find the one you like best.
- If you like it sweeter, add a teaspoon of honey or a sugar substitute.
